Liverpool boss Klopp: Fabinho progress spectacular

Liverpool boss Jurgen Klopp admits Fabinho's progress this season has been "spectacular".

After a slow start to his Anfield following a £40million move from Monaco last summer, Fabinho's influence on Liverpool's title challenge has grown steadily in recent months.

“Fabinho was really good for sure," Klopp said of his performance in victory over Watford.

“It was one of his much better games. He had some spectacular moments - getting the ball, a little steal here or there, really good.

“Organisation wise, he was brilliant. Protection wise, he was brilliant. Football wise, he was really good. For sure, it was one of his top games."

Asked what had changed for Fabinho, Klopp added: "He's just feeling more natural in his position.

"He's a very nice boy and a very smart boy as well. He wants to do everything right.

"A couple of things changed for him, intensity wise and tactical understanding as well.

"But he did not need that as much as he maybe thought. Sometimes you leave the boys a little bit to adapt naturally to it and not give them so much information. Some things happen then."
